What is the Pinal County Employee Status Change Form?
The Pinal County Employee Status Change Form is a critical document used to officially document any changes in an employee's status within the Human Resources Department of Pinal County. This form serves to maintain accurate employment records, ensuring that both the employee and the organization have a clear understanding of any modifications made to employment conditions. The form is utilized for a variety of status changes, including position, department, or salary adjustments.
Key roles such as Supervisors, Elected Officials, and HR Representatives are typically involved in signing this form to validate the changes, enhancing the integrity of the employment process.

Who Needs the Pinal County Employee Status Change Form?
The Pinal County Employee Status Change Form is essential for various stakeholders within the organization. Roles responsible for signing the form include:
-
Supervisors
-
Elected Officials
-
HR Representatives
-
County Department Directors
Eligible employees undergoing status changes are also required to submit this form. Specific scenarios that necessitate its use include promotions, demotions, or changes in work hours and responsibilities, making it a vital document for effective employee management.

Who is eligible to use the Pinal County Employee Status Change Form?
Any Pinal County employee undergoing a status change is eligible to use this form. Additionally, supervisors, HR representatives, and department heads must also be involved in completing and signing the form.
What information do I need to complete this form?
You'll need the effective date of the status change, complete employee information (name, ID, department), the reason for the change, and any applicable details such as updates to marital status or address.

Do I need to notarize the Pinal County Employee Status Change Form?
No, notarization is not required for completing the Pinal County Employee Status Change Form. However, it must be signed by all necessary parties as indicated on the form.
